Which statistical measure would you use if an outlier is present (mean, median, mode, or rang)? Explain.

Functioning as a balance point (like a teeter-totter), the mean is most influenced by outlying scores. The range also is very effected by outlying scores. With outliers, the distribution is likely to be skewed, so the most central measure of central tendency would be the median.
